Bram Stoker's Dracula is a video game released for the Super Nintendo, Sega Mega Drive, Sega CD and Amiga games consoles. Based on the film of the same name (see Bram Stoker's Dracula), each version of the game was essentially identical; the only difference being that the Sega CD edition borrowed the film's musical score, along with select video clips. In the game you play as Johnathan Harker. Throughout levels Abraham Van Helsing will aid you in your quest by providing advanced weapons. The game is of the side-scrolling genre. In the game, the character fights Dracula in numerous forms, Lucy Westenra as a vampire, Dracula's brides, and Renfield.
